How PostalBridge works for content creators

Use a professional mailing address for partnerships, fan mail, and business paperwork without publishing your residence.

Step 1

Choose a location

Review live locations, plan limits, and handling options before choosing the address you will rely on.

Step 2

Complete USPS verification

Finish Form 1583 and upload the required documents so the mail center can receive mail on your behalf.

Step 3

Handle mail online

Review envelopes, request scans, forward originals, and keep the workflow moving from wherever you are.

Do I still need USPS Form 1583?
Yes. USPS verification is required before a CMRA can receive mail on your behalf.
